How No Deposit Bonuses Actually Work

Forget the marketing hype for a second. A no deposit bonus is essentially a test drive. The casino gives you a small amount of credit—usually between £5 and £20—or a handful of free spins just for registering an account. You don't need to add funds to your wallet to activate it.

However, you can't just withdraw that money immediately. It comes with conditions. The most critical one is the wagering requirement. This is a multiplier that dictates how many times you must play through the bonus before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, if you get £10 with a 30x wagering requirement, you need to place bets totaling £300 before the money converts to withdrawable cash. Some UK casinos have lowered these requirements to 1x or 5x to compete, which is where the real value lies.

Free Spins vs. Free Cash

Operators structure these bonuses in two ways. The first is free cash, which is credited to your balance to use on various games. The second, and far more common in the UK market, is free spins. These are usually locked to specific slot titles like Starburst, Big Bass Bonanza, or Book of Dead. Spins are easier for casinos to control because they limit your exposure to high-RTP games, but they are also easier for players to clear because the win potential is clearly defined.

Wagering Requirements Explained

Always check the terms for the phrase “wagering requirements”. A £20 bonus with 40x wagering is significantly harder to clear than a £5 bonus with 1x wagering. The lower the multiplier, the better your odds of actually seeing a return. Some casinos, like those in the Rank Group brands (e.g., Grosvenor), offer bingo tickets with no wagering, meaning anything you win is yours to keep immediately. That is the gold standard for these promotions.

Payments and Verification

Even if you aren't depositing to get the bonus, you will eventually need a payment method to withdraw your winnings. UK casinos are strict about anti-money laundering (AML) checks. You can't just claim a £10 bonus and withdraw £50 without proving who you are.

Be prepared to upload a copy of your passport or driving licence and a recent utility bill. This verification process is standard for any UKGC-licensed casino. Using e-wallets like PayPal or Skrill is often the smoothest way to handle transactions, though some bonuses exclude deposits made via e-wallets. In the UK, Visa and Mastercard are universally accepted and reliable for withdrawals, usually taking 1-3 banking days to process after the casino approves the request.

The Withdrawal Cap Reality

This is the detail most players miss. Most no deposit bonuses come with a maximum withdrawal limit. A casino might give you 20 free spins, and you might hit a jackpot, but the terms might cap your winnings at £50 or £100. It feels like a rip-off when you see it in action, but from the casino's perspective, they can't be handing out life-changing sums for free. Always scan the T&Cs for a “max cashout” clause so you know what to expect before you spin.

Why do casinos give away free money?

It is a marketing cost. Operators calculate that the lifetime value of a new customer is worth more than the cost of a few free spins or a small cash credit. They are betting that once you try their platform, you will stay and make a real money deposit later.
